你查询的IP:[118.89.190.238]  地理位置:中国–上海–上海

最新查询116.66.155.166 202.95.179.195 122.198.60.141 119.19.186.229 121.204.238.82 120.52.172.246 123.112.58.157 121.68.244.192 119.10.252.177 118.89.190.238 202.209.110.119 119.112.158.137 166.111.54.51 122.192.219.133 210.79.64.146 220.152.128.36 121.52.160.37 202.123.96.108 203.83.56.181 58.192.153.116 60.63.118.162 202.45.176.31 119.44.33.170 61.47.128.151 202.158.160.114 222.128.102.254 119.55.188.207 119.144.71.122 203.208.206.241 210.78.213.126 202.127.48.66